The next day.

After Mashauva's classes ended, she went straight to the canteen to buy about a dozen bottles of water.

Only then did she go to the field with bags of water in hand.

Before she arrived, the boys on the basketball court were joking amongst themselves.

"Do you think that the girl from yesterday will come by later?"

"Who knows. She wasn't feeling well yesterday, so she probably won't be jogging today. She might need to rest for a few days. God knows what time she woke up yesterday."

"But even if she doesn't run today, she'll at least come to thank us, right?"

"C'mon, dude, you shouldn't help someone just because you want them to thank you. That's emotional blackmail."

"Alas."

"Look, who's that?"

The group of boys became excited when they saw Masahuva on the track.

"Here she comes. She's really here."

"What's in her hand? The bag looks heavy, but I'm not sure what it is."

"D*mn, can it be that she bought us gifts because we helped her yesterday?"

As Mashauva approached them, they noticed she had a rosy tinge to her fair skin. She looked charming and adorable.

"Dude, I think I'm in love."

"Who would've thought girls with some meat on their bones can be quite cute too."

"She's coming. Shush."

Mashauva finally reached them, carrying the bag of bottled water.

"Hi, everyone."
